Quickbooks Commerce only supports tax exclusive settings

Tax inclusive orders in Quickbooks Commerce are not allowed. European sales are tax inclusive - can't import order with VAT included. Looks like the software is suitable for US only. Is there anything being done about it?

Chat support said - nothing they can do...What's the point of QB Commerce if i have to create orders manually.

 

Also there's no product selection for Quickbooks Commerce. Are you planning on opening one, Intuit?

Have been very frustrated with QB Commerce since the day I migrated to it. Very undeveloped software.

I can share information about automated sales tax in QuickBooks Online.

 

QuickBooks Online US can only cater US sales taxes. Thus, the option to import invoices with VAT info is unavailable. I suggest using our QBO UK or Global versions so you can perform the said task. From there, you also have the option to set the tax to either inclusive or exclusive.
